What is an associate narrative designer?
Career: Associate Narrative Designer
Associate Narrative Designers are entry-level professionals who help create the story, dialogue, and overall narrative structure for video games or interactive media. They work closely with senior narrative designers, writers, and other game development team members to develop characters, plotlines, and immersive storytelling experiences. Their responsibilities often include writing in-game text, assisting with world-building, and ensuring the narrative aligns with gameplay and design. This role is ideal for individuals with strong writing skills, creativity, and a passion for storytelling in interactive formats.
